Ingredients

  • 1 (8 inch) prepared graham cracker crust
  • 1 cup sweetened condensed milk
  • 1 cup applesauce
  • 2 teaspoons apple juice
  • ¼ teaspoon ground cinnamon, or to taste
  • 2 eggs

Information

  • Prep Time: 10 mins
  • Cook Time: 1 hr
  • Additional Time: 30 mins
  • Total Time: 1 hr 40 mins
  • Servings: 6
  • Yield: 1 8-inch pie

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Mix the sweetened condensed milk with applesauce in a saucepan, and thin with apple juice. Whisk in cinnamon; bring to a boil. Beat the eggs in a bowl; whisk 1 tablespoon of the hot applesauce mixture into the eggs; whisk 1 more tablespoon of applesauce mixture into the eggs, and repeat, mixing in 1 tablespoon at a time, until about 1/3 of the applesauce mixture is whisked into the eggs. Return the egg mixture to the saucepan with the remaining applesauce mixture, and whisk until smooth. Pour the filling into the crust.
  • Bake until the filling is set, about 1 hour; allow to cool before serving. Refrigerate leftovers.
